New discoveries about dark matter.




Fan discovered a candidate galaxy for a dark or quasi-dark galaxy, since it is composed almost entirely of dark matter, it is about 300 million light years from Earth. It has a brightness of the few stars it has of around 6 million suns, that is almost ridiculous if we compare it with the brightness of the Milky Way, which has a brightness equivalent to tens of billions of times the brightness of the Sun, what happens is that this galaxy is composed of 99.99% dark matter, invisible to our eyes,


This has been known thanks to the globular clusters that act as satellites of this galaxy, so they have seen that there are globular clusters around this galaxy that in principle should not be there, but are there due to the incredible mass of dark matter that exists in this dark galaxy.

Additionally, they published a study on March 11, where they stated that our galaxy is wrapped in a pancake, it is not a good analogy, I have read the research and really the best analogy would be a Neapolitan pizza. because it turns out that what the researchers did was study the galaxies of the local group, they have studied about 31, the Andromeda and a few others, those that surround us, and that the edges of that sheet of dark matter that not only covers our galaxy, but also covers those 31 more galaxies of the local group, that layer of dark matter is enormous, it turns out that the edges are much thicker than the center and that is why those much thicker and denser edges of dark matter pull the galaxies towards the edges.


And this would explain a mystery of decades in astronomy and that is that astronomers did not explain why the galaxies of the local nucleus move away from us, yes, on a large scale in the universe everything moves away from everything, it is the expansion of the universe, but on a small scale of the local group, we are talking about the local group, it should not be like that, gravity should stop this expansion at a small level of the local group, that they move away from us is due precisely to that "pizza" of dark matter that surrounds us, where in the edges, dark matter is much denser.


We don't really know what dark matter is, there are theories, there are speculations, it is much more abundant than normal matter, in fact, there is about five times more dark matter than normal matter, if we do a calculation of everything in the universe, mass and energy, everything, normal matter, baryonic matter, which forms our bodies, our planet, the stars, etc., is between 4.9% and 5% of the total content. of the universe. Dark matter would be 26.8 to 27% of the total and dark energy, which is what makes the universe expand, would be 68% 70% of the total.


Black holes, normal ones, those with stellar mass, those that form when a massive star collapses, those are within normal matter, even supermassive ones would fall within normal matter, although we know that supermassive ones also eat dark matter. What could be a solution to dark matter would be the primordial black holes that supposedly all formed during the Big Bang.


These primordial black holes can have a mass of any mass, they can range from supermassive black holes to having the mass of the moon. and be very small, but they would fit into dark matter because they were created during the Big Bang, but just before the atoms emerged, therefore, they are not made up of atoms, they are made up of whatever matter existed at that time, call it strange matter, if you want.
